Abstract:
Objective To investigate the clinical advantages and safety of an acupoint auto-positioning moxibustion robot combined with massage techniques in the treatment of lumbar disc herniation.Methods Totally 114 patients with lumbar disc herniation treated between June 2021 and December 2023 at Yueyang Hospital of Integrated Traditional Chinese and Western Medicine,Shanghai University of Traditional Chinese Medicine,the Outpatient Department of Rehabilitation Medicine,Changhai Hospital and Shanghai Third Rehabilitation Hospital were divided into control group and experimental group with random number table method,with 57 cases in each group.The control group received conventional moxibustion combined with massage techniques,while the experimental group was treated using an acupoint auto-positioning moxibustion robot combined with massage techniques.Both groups underwent treatment once every three days,totaling 10 sessions over one month.Clinical efficacy was observed between the two groups by comparing pre-treatment and post-treatment(after 3,6 and 10 sessions)scores on the visual analogue scale(VAS)for pain,the Japanese Orthopaedic Association(JOA)lower back pain score,and lumbar range of motion(LROM).Adverse reactions during the intervention were recorded.Satisfaction with the moxibustion robot in the experimental group was assessed using a Likert scale.Additionally,20 healthy subjects were recruited to evaluate the accuracy of the robot's acupoint auto-positioning function.Results The overall effective rate was 91.23%(52/57)in the experimental group and 94.74%(54/57)in the control group,without statistical significance between the two groups(P>0.05).Compared to pre-treatment,both groups showed significant improvements in VAS scores,JOA scores and LROM across all measured directions after 3,6,and 10 treatment sessions(P<0.001).In the Likert scale assessment,86.96%of subjects agreed that the device was convenient to use,87.72%agreed that the device was safer than conventional moxibustion therapy,and 94.74%were willing to recommend the device to other patients.The accuracy evaluation of the acupoint auto-positioning moxibustion robot demonstrated that the average deviation between robot-positioned acupoints and standard acupoints was(1.68±0.46)mm,achieving a positioning accuracy rate exceeding 95%.No adverse reactions were reported during the intervention.Conclusion The combination of an acupoint auto-positioning moxibustion robot with massage techniques is as effective as conventional moxibustion combined with massage techniques in improving clinical symptoms,alleviating pains,enhancing lumbar function and increasing lumbar mobility in patients with lumbar disc herniation.Participants have exhibited a high willingness to use the device,and the robot achieved a high accuracy rate in acupoint positioning.
